Website Traffic Resources



When checking out website performance and customer involvement, comprehending the sources of traffic is crucial for services looking for to maximize their on the internet presence. By delving right into the web traffic sources in Google Analytics, companies can obtain valuable understandings right into where their website visitors are originating from. This data categorizes website traffic right into networks such as organic search, direct, reference, social, and paid search.


Organic search web traffic stems from internet search engine results, showing site visitors that discovered the website through a search question. Direct web traffic represents people that entered the website link directly right into their internet browser. Reference web traffic comes from outside websites connecting to the site. Social web traffic is generated from social media sites platforms. Paid search website traffic arises from online marketing campaign.

Bounce Rate



To additionally assess the involvement and efficiency of a web site, analyzing the bounce price is important. The bounce price in Google Analytics describes the percentage of visitors who browse away from a site after watching only one page, instead than remaining to check out other web pages within the very same site. A high bounce rate could show that visitors are not locating the content they anticipated, the site is tough to browse, or the touchdown web page does not line up with the site visitor's intent.
